IN PART VII we proceed to applications for which a speech signal is generated for human listeners. As with recognition, we begin with classical methods and then extend the discussion to the more refined approaches that are current.
Chapter 30 describes the basics of speech-synthesis systems. Although many modern systems are concatenative, newer approaches based on statistical analysis-synthesis methods are also discussed, as well as several methods that are of historical interest. Chapter 31 proceeds to describe basic approaches to pitch detection, which is still a difficult problem. Many modern coding systems avoid this difficulty by not making an explicit pitch determination per se, but this information is still important for some applications.
